St Kitts and Nevis Patriots to Face Off Against Jamaica Kingsmen in CPL 2026 Match

The Caribbean Premier League (CPL) 2026 continues with the St Kitts and Nevis Patriots (SKN) gearing up to take on the Jamaica Kingsmen (JK) in a crucial match on Friday, August 28 at the Warner Park in Basseterre, St Kitts. Currently, both teams are looking to secure a win and improve their standings in the tournament.

St Kitts and Nevis Patriots Overview

The St Kitts and Nevis Patriots have had a challenging season so far, having won only one match out of the four they have played. With a negative net run-rate (NRR) of -0.794, the team is currently at the bottom of the points table. However, they still have a chance to turn their campaign around and will be aiming for a victory against the Kingsmen to start their comeback.

Jamaica Kingsmen Overview

On the other hand, the Jamaica Kingsmen have won a couple of matches out of their six encounters and are currently placed fourth on the leaderboard. While their path to the playoffs seems relatively straightforward, they will need to secure important points in the upcoming matches, as they only have four league-stage games remaining.

Match Details

The match will take place at the Warner Park in Basseterre, St Kitts, with the pitch expected to favor high-scoring games. Bowlers might find it challenging on this deck, but spinners could play a crucial role in the middle overs by taking important breakthroughs.

Probable Best Performers of the Match

Probable Best Batter: Andre Fletcher

Andre Fletcher has been in great form recently, providing stability to the St Kitts and Nevis Patriots’ batting lineup. Despite the team’s struggles, Fletcher’s experience and skills make him a key player to watch out for in the upcoming match.

Probable Best Bowler: Andre Russell

Andre Russell has been a standout performer with the ball for the Jamaica Kingsmen in the CPL 2026 season. With nine wickets in six matches, Russell’s experience and ability to take crucial wickets will be crucial for his team’s success in the match against the Patriots.
